While Mbappe scored a brace, Vinicius also added a goal and an assist to help Real Madrid secure a dominant 3-0 victory away at Real Oviedo, maintaining their perfect start after two rounds.
Real Madrid faced many challenges traveling to Real Oviedo’s stadium. Under increasing pressure, the team led by coach Xabi Alonso showed strong determination and superior class.
After wins by Barcelona and Villarreal, Real Madrid entered the match needing points. Alonso’s surprising choice to bench Vinicius and start Rodrygo made the game even more intense. The first half was controlled by Real Madrid. Despite creating many chances, it was only in the 37th minute that Kylian Mbappe scored with excellent skill and finishing, putting the "White Falcons" ahead.
